构建后重新使用 Caffe 文件

Re-using Caffe files after building it

我按照 https://github.com/BVLC/caffe/tree/windowsWindows 10 上成功构建了 Caffe。

然后,将C:\Projects\caffe\python\caffe文件夹复制到我的Python site_packages文件夹后,我就可以在Python中使用"import caffe"了。

我的问题是,如果我想在其他电脑上使用Caffe,而不需要从头构建Caffe,我是否只需要将C:\Projects\caffe\python\caffe folder中的文件复制到其他电脑的site_packages文件夹中?

其实我对'build'和'compile'不熟悉,也不知道'build'在安装Caffe的过程中做了什么

只要目标计算机使用相同的支持库(用于软件链接到您的 Python 和 Caffe)并且具有 bit-compatible 硬件(以支持二进制代码),您就可以进行复制。

我经常在一个受控的集群中这样做。所有节点都具有相同的 OS 配置。我在一个节点上构建,然后将整个目录复制到其他节点上的同一个地方。然后我运行multi-node申请就结果。

如果您切换到不同的核心处理器或不同的 OS 实现,您尝试使用结果可能会崩溃。我也试过那个。 :-)